Dimensions

Cargo Area Dimensions
  • Trunk Volume - 12.8 ft³
Exterior Dimensions
  • Height, Overall - 55.7 in
  • Length, Overall - 187.6 in
  • Track Width, Front - 61.1 in
  • Track Width, Rear - 61.2 in
  • Wheelbase - 105.1 in
  • Width, Max w/o mirrors - 71.3 in
Interior Dimensions
  • Front Head Room - 37.5 in
  • Front Hip Room - 54.2 in
  • Front Leg Room - 43.1 in
  • Front Shoulder Room - 56.1 in
  • Passenger Capacity - 5
  • Passenger Volume - 88.0 ft³
  • Second Head Room - 36.1 in
  • Second Hip Room - 46.1 in
  • Second Leg Room - 31.9 in
  • Second Shoulder Room - 55.4 in

Powertrain

Cooling System
  • Total Cooling System Capacity - 7.1 qts
Electrical
  • Maximum Alternator Capacity (amps) - 80
Engine
  • Displacement - 2.4L/144
  • Engine Type - Gas I4
  • Fuel System - MPFI
  • SAE Net Horsepower @ RPM - 160 @ 5500
  • SAE Net Torque @ RPM - 161 @ 4500
Mileage
  • EPA Fuel Economy Est - City - 24 MPG
  • EPA Fuel Economy Est - Hwy - 34 MPG
Transmission
  • Drivetrain - Front Wheel Drive
  • Fifth Gear Ratio (:1) - 0.57
  • Final Drive Axle Ratio (:1) - 4.44
  • First Gear Ratio (:1) - 2.65
  • Fourth Gear Ratio (:1) - 0.74
  • Reverse Ratio (:1) - 2.00
  • Second Gear Ratio (:1) - 1.52
  • Third Gear Ratio (:1) - 1.04
  • Trans Description Cont. - Automatic w/OD
  • Trans Type - 5
